Bugatti type 40 pickup
Bugatti automobile bodied as a pickup for Lieutenant Frédéric Loiseau's raid in Africa, kept at the National Automobile Museum in Mulhouse (Haut-Rhin, Alsace, France) ; classified as a Historical Monument Object (PM68001713)
